Less-Known Bonuses That Are Actually Real
Here are some bonus types that aren’t talked about much, but can really pay off if you know they exist:
-
Birthday gifts — Some casinos will quietly credit you with free spins or bonus cash on your birthday. You might need to verify your date of birth first.
-
Comeback offers — Haven’t played in a while? You might get an email with a “we miss you” deal. Usually free spins or free balance.
-
Live chat boosts — Some players report getting a little something extra just by asking politely in the live chat, especially after a bad run.
-
Game testing spins — When a casino adds a new slot, it may offer hidden spins on it to selected users. These usually aren’t advertised.
-
Late-night codes — Some casinos quietly test offers between midnight and 6 am to see who’s playing during quiet hours.
